    Key Features to Prioritize

    Lumbar support is non-negotiable. Look for chairs with adjustable lower back support that can be moved up and down to fit your spine’s curvature. Without this, your lower back slumps, leading to significant strain over time. Next, consider seat depth. The seat pan should be deep enough to support your thighs but not so deep that it presses against the back of your knees, which restricts circulation. Adjustable armrests are equally crucial. They should allow your elbows to rest at a ninety-degree angle, keeping your shoulders relaxed and preventing upper back tension. Finally, breathability matters. Mesh backs allow air circulation, keeping you cool and comfortable during intense work sessions.

    Step 1: Activate POS in Your Admin

    The first critical step is to ensure that the POS feature is enabled in your Shopify admin dashboard. Navigate to your settings and select the “Point of Sale” tab. If you are on a plan that does not include POS, you may need to upgrade to Shopify POS Pro or ensure you are using the correct version of Shopify POS Lite. Once enabled, you will see an option to “Add POS device.” Click this button to initiate the setup process. It is crucial to verify that your Shopify plan supports the specific POS features you intend to use, as some advanced hardware integrations require higher-tier subscriptions.

    Step 2: Download the POS App

    After activating the feature, you must download the Shopify POS app on your preferred device. For tablet users, this typically means downloading the app from the Apple App Store or Google Play Store. Ensure that your device meets the minimum system requirements for smooth performance. Once installed, open the app and sign in with the same Shopify account credentials you used in the admin dashboard. The app will automatically detect your store configuration, making it easy to sync your products, customers, and inventory data across all platforms.

    Step 3: Configure Your Hardware

    Shopify POS supports a variety of hardware, including barcode scanners, receipt printers, and cash drawers. Connect these devices to your tablet or computer using Bluetooth or USB cables, depending on the hardware type. In the POS app, go to the settings menu and select “Hardware.” Follow the on-screen instructions to pair each device. Test each piece of hardware individually to ensure it is functioning correctly. For example, print a test receipt and verify that the cash drawer opens when prompted. Proper configuration here prevents issues during live transactions.

    Step 4: Finalize Settings and Start Selling

    Before going live, take time to customize your POS settings. Set up your payment processors, configure tax rates, and define your return policies. You can also organize your product collections to make it easier for staff to find items quickly. Once everything is configured, perform a test transaction to ensure the entire flow works smoothly. This includes processing a payment, printing a receipt, and updating inventory levels. After confirming that all systems are operational, you are ready to start serving customers.     Edge Computing and the IoT Expansion

    The proliferation of Internet of Things devices has necessitated a shift from cloud-centric to edge-centric computing architectures. Edge computing processes data closer to the source, reducing latency and bandwidth usage, which is critical for real-time applications like autonomous vehicles and smart manufacturing. With the rollout of 5G networks, the connectivity infrastructure supporting these edge devices is becoming more robust and reliable. This combination allows for instantaneous data processing, enabling machines to make split-second decisions without waiting for cloud server responses. Industries such as healthcare are utilizing edge computing for remote patient monitoring, where immediate data analysis can be life-saving. The industrial sector benefits from predictive maintenance systems that detect anomalies in machinery before they lead to costly downtime. As sensor technology becomes more affordable and powerful, the scope of edge applications continues to expand, creating a more responsive and efficient digital ecosystem.
